A NeoVim plugin for tracking time spent on files, projects, repositories, and filetypes with local logging and inactivity detection.
Usage-Tracker.nvim is a NeoVim plugin that automatically logs the time developers spend working in different buffers, files, projects, and filetypes. It solves the problem of manually tracking coding activity by providing automated, privacy-focused time analytics directly within the editor. The plugin helps users understand their work patterns and optimize their workflow through detailed visual reports.
NeoVim users who want to analyze their coding habits, track time spent on specific projects or filetypes, and improve personal productivity without relying on external time-tracking services.
Developers choose Usage-Tracker.nvim because it offers fully local time tracking by default, ensuring data privacy, while providing rich, customizable reports and optional telemetry for advanced users. Its inactivity detection and flexible aggregation commands make it more accurate and useful than manual tracking methods.
NeoVim plugin with which you can track the time you spent on files, projects, repos, filetypes
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.